Early Life

Phillip Adams, born on December 12, 1939, in Australia, is a renowned radio host and farmer. His career in media began at a young age, as he worked in advertising at Foote, Cone & Belding when he was just 16 years old. It was during this time that Adams also joined the Communist Party of Australia, showcasing his early interest in social issues and activism.

Professional Career

Adams made his mark in the media industry as the host of the popular ABC radio program, Late Night Live. Known for his thought-provoking interviews and discussions, Adams has become a respected voice in Australian media.

Aside from his work in radio, Adams has also been actively involved in various organizations and boards. He has served on the board for companies such as Film Victoria and Greenpeace Australia, demonstrating his commitment to environmental and cultural causes.

Contributions to Society

One of Adams' notable contributions to society was his chairmanship of the Commission for the Future and the National Australia Day Council. These roles allowed him to influence and shape important national conversations and initiatives.
